  20. I have found the front tighten knives, even the X-acto handles lose their grip of blades over time. I prefer the rear tighten like the picture I posted above. Used one at work for 20 some years at it still holds well today. The old front or top tighten does not, only used it for 5 years to find that out. I will say that the off brand knives will not always retract in the retractable handles I use at home. The blades are a little wide to retract back inside the handle.
